I have 2 columns of data, appname and appdate. I have 4 years worth of data.
What I'd like to do is add a column (new app this year) to identify new appname I.e if we take 2024, those that have come in this year onky but we don't have a record of them in the previous 3 years.
Any idea if this is possible please and to also make it work once we hit 2025 on so on please?

Hi @M_SBS_6 ,
Please try:
Column 1 =
VAR _max_year = YEAR(MAX('Table'[appdate]))
VAR _cur_appname = 'Table'[appname]
VAR _count = CALCULATE(COUNTROWS('Table'),YEAR('Table'[appdate])<_max_year && 'Table'[appname]=_cur_appname)
VAR _result = IF(ISBLANK(_count),"Yes")
RETURN
_result
or (last 3 years):
Column 2 =
VAR _max_year = YEAR(MAX('Table'[appdate]))
VAR _min_year = _max_year - 3
VAR _cur_appname = 'Table'[appname]
VAR _count = CALCULATE(COUNTROWS('Table'),'Table'[appname]=_cur_appname && YEAR('Table'[appdate])>=_min_year && YEAR('Table'[appdate])<_max_year)
VAR _result = IF(YEAR('Table'[appdate])=_max_year&&ISBLANK(_count),"Yes")
RETURN
_result
